The Congress will soon launch 'Shakti' — a contact initiative in the poll-bound Rajasthan to let party president Rahul Gandhi and other AICC leaders directly communicate with grassroots workers to strengthen the state unit ahead of assembly elections.

Expected to be launched before the second week of March, the initiative is the brainchild of the party president himself. It comes as the party is taking efforts to energise its state body by directly engaging with the workers.

The Congress hopes that a direct communication with the president will help boost the morale of party workers who are already upbeat with three wins in the recently held bypolls and are eager to wrest back power from Vasundhara Raje-led state government.

'Shakti' is the party's technology intervention. Under this, Rahul Gandhi and chosen senior leaders will be able to communicate with anyone or all party workers via phone call, text, video, etc. In addition, the workers will also get notifications about party events.

The Congress's Rajasthan unit had last year tasked 230 coordinators with creating a data base of its ground-level functionaries, numbering around 16 lakh.

Apart from 'Shakti', the Congress will also implement its "Mera Booth, Mera Gaurav" programme to micromanage its poll campaign.
